100 Examples of sentences containing the verb "verify"
Definition
The verb verify means to confirm the truth, accuracy, or validity of something through evidence or examination.
Synonyms
- Confirm
- Validate
- Authenticate
- Substantiate
- Corroborate
- Check
- Ratify
- Certify
- Ascertain
- Prove
Antonyms
- Disprove
- Refute
- Deny
- Invalidate
- Contradict
- Negate
- Dismiss
- Reject
- Question
- Doubt
